NG System Data
Max. Supply
14"WC (3.45 Kpa)
Pressure
Min. Supply
5" WC (1.25 kpa)
Pressure
Manifold Pressure
3.8" WC (0.87 kpa)
Orifice Size
#32 DMS
Maximum Input
39,000 Btu/h
(11.43 kW)
Minimum Input
21,000 Btu/h
(6.15 kW)
LP System Data
Max. Supply Pressure
14"WC (3.45 Kpa)
Min. Supply Pressure
11" WC (2.73 kpa)
Manifold Pressure
10.5" WC (2.49 kpa)
Orifice Size
#50 DMS
Maximum Input
36,000 Btu/h
(10.55 kW)
Minimum Input
19,500 Btu/h
(5.71 KW)

High Elevation

This unit is approved for altitude 0 to 4500 ft.
(CAN1 2.17-M91).

Gas Line Installation

Since some municipalities have additional local
codes, it is always best to consult with your local
authorities and the CSA B149.1 installation code.
For U.S.A. installations, follow local codes and/or
the current National Fuel Gas Code, ANSI Z223.1.
Use approved fittings with copper or flex connec-
tors. Always provide a union so that gas lines can
be easily disconnected for servicing. Flare nuts
for copper lines and flex connectors usually meet
this requirement.
Always check for gas leaks with a soap and
water solution or gas leak detector. Do not use
open flame for leak testing.
A shutoff / dante valve should be supplied in or
near the unit (or as per local codes) for ease of
servicing this appliance.

Pilot Adjustment

Periodically check the pilot flames. Correct flame
pattern has two strong blue flames: 1 flowing around
the flame sensor and 1 flowing across the burner
(it does not have to touch the burner).
If you have an incorrect flame pattern, contact
your Regency® dealer for further instructions.
Incorrect flame pattern will have small, probably
yellow flames, not coming into proper contact with
the rear burner or flame sensor.

Gas Pipe Pressure Testing

During pressure testing of the gas supply piping
system at pressures equal to or less than 1/2 psig.
(3.45 kPa), close the appliance's manual shutoff
valve to isolated it from the gas supply. Disconnect
the piping from the valve at pressures over 1/2 psig.
The manifold pressure is controlled by a regulator
built into the gas control and should be checked
at the pressure test point.
To properly check gas pressure, both inlet and
manifold pressures should be checked using the
valve pressure ports on the valve.
1
Make sure the unit is in the "OFF" position.
2. Loosen the "IN" and/or "OUT" pressure tap(s),
turning counterclockwise with a 1/8" wide flat
screwdriver.
3. Attach manometer to "IN" and/or "OUT" pres-
sure tap(s) using a 5/16" ID hose.
4. Turn the unit on with the remote or wall switch.
5. The pressure check should be carried out with
the unit burning and the setting within the limits
specified on the safety label.
6. When finished reading the manometer, turn off
the unit, disconnect the hose, and tighten the
screw (clockwise) with a 1/8" flat screwdriver.
Screw should be snug, but do not over tighten.
